my log id: b7949b8a502fe2db84a39b1c
I tried to register my GitHub account, JoshuaFox. Here is the gist https://gist.github.com/JoshuaFox/6d1a6e4cd8d9b521dc17310c3e7e5fc4 Unfortunately, Keybase is not reading this correctly.
Maybe this is because my GitHub is JoshuaFox but in Keybase, it appears in lowercase as joshuafox. Worse, I cannot remove joshuafox and retry as JoshuaFox
Note that GitHub does treat usernames as case-insensitive: https://github.com/JoshuaFox and https://github.com/joshuafox show the same profile
